Academic Comparison between Torah Temimah Talmudical Seminary and NYIT

Torah Temimah Talmudical Seminary and New York Institute of Technology are frequently compared when students or parents prepare college admissions. Both Schools are four-year, private (not-for-profit) and located in New York

Comparison at a Glance

The following list compares two colleges briefly in important perspectives. You can compare them with comprehensive information on full comparison page.

  • Both schools are four-year, private (not-for-profit) schools.
  • NYIT has more expensive tuition & fees ($46,560) than Torah Temimah Talmudical Seminary ($9,600).
  • It is harder to admit to Torah Temimah Talmudical Seminary than NYIT.
  • NYIT has more students with 6,877 students while Torah Temimah Talmudical Seminary has 82 students.
  • NYIT has a lower number of students per faculty with 12 to 1 while Torah Temimah Talmudical Seminary's ratio is 27 to 1.
  • NYIT has more full-time faculties with 317 faculties while Torah Temimah Talmudical Seminary has 2 full-time faculties.
